Arcanum was involved an indie film entitled "Obession" (was called "The Novel" ) with Brett in a small part as one of the bad guys. The producers saw "The Visual Scream" video compilation and cast him for the part. The remix of "I Love the People That Hurt Me" will be used in the film as well. They are also doing the theme song to a spoof of Mission Impossible/James Bond-type films - it is called "La Mission De L'Impossible". Hopefully, it get into two festivals and more in the future. Another special film called Standing on Contradictions (in conjunction with the Warehouse Actors Theater in Atlanta, W.H.A.T.) was written by Brett last spring and recites a story about four old friends who are growing apart. The band also submitted a song for the Jonatha Brooke Tribute cd that is under works. They have recorded "Is This All?", and hopefully that will appear on that cd too. On the homefront, the guys having a new EP called Dragging Canvasses and Breathing Lies. The sound is a combination of acoustic guitars, slowed down jungle beats, strings and pianos. Another Canvas Dragged is the video compliment to the EP. Arcanum also has a new CD, No Mercy for Virgin Soil, however, it does not have a distributor and available through Arcanum themselves. 1999 started with a bang as Arcanum was named as the Indie Journal's World Wide Musical Artist of the Month for January. Brett's solo project Subculture is also in the works. He has also been doing lots of outside production work including tracks for folk singer Johnette, a track for the rapper Majestic and hired to do the score for another indie film. Shaz will once again be making the rounds in New York City and Los Angeles working on getting his poetry and essays published. In the summer of 1999, the band even found out they were being bootlegged in Russia - sort of a backhanded compliment. Check them out for yourselves.
